Im new here :) I own a total of 5 sheepies...Armani-8,Adorian-6,Antesian-2,Ashely-Brooke-2,Clyde-14mos. I am wondering about something with my my babies. Anteisan is deaf and every since i brought him home Armani has been very protective over him. Such as when Adorian and Antesian will start to play...Armani will come and stand guard between the two i guess to make sure that no fighting is involved. When he sees all is well then he will back off but still keep close watch over him. Armani is kind of a non-social sheepie...the others play with each other but he just wants to play when he feels like it and if one of the others comes to him he growls and walks away.. Armani is not like that with any of the others only Antesian. He will let him do anything he wants to him but none of the others.

Does anyone know why this could be?

I forgot to add, Antesian will hide behind Armani or go under his legs and start to bark at the others. Not an aggressive bark just a playful one. I call Anteisan my one man band lol. Although he is deaf, he is the most loving to everyone and everything them any of them. He is the only dog ive ever seen wag his tail in his sleep :)

I have had now 3 deaf OES and they typically have a "foster"
dog that takes care of them...
My first Kissy was adopted by our other male Wilby and they did
everything together...
Kismet totally relied on Wilby!

My second deaf OES is Fiiners...
We adopted him when I had my other male Quin..(not deaf)
Finn is so totally like Quin was....
You would have thought Quin gave birth to Finn
he "mothered" him so much...
Sadly, Quin passed at a young age so, that bond was lost :cry:

My third deaf OES is Georgie Peaches who should be the poster child
for deaf dogs!
She is oblivious and LOVES everything and everybody!
Even our "difficult" fosters love her...
